GIS Day 2011

On November 17 the world marked the Day of Geographic Information Systems.

For the thirteenth year in a row ESRI Bulgaria organizes GIS Day in Bulgaria. This year the event was conducted under the patronage of the Ministry of Transport and Communications and the Ministry of Environment and Water and courtesy of Republic of Bulgaria, GIS Varna and Bulgarian GIS geo-information company.

Partners of the GIS Day were: Partners of the GIS day were: BASCOM, BAGIS, BGBC, Green Balkans, NAMB, FLGR, Bulgarian Cartographic Association, Sofia University, UACEG, UMG, UF. The event was organized with the support of the media from the newspaper City Building.

As every year, the Global GIS Day was celebrated with an official cocktail, in which prizes were awarded for special achievements in GIS. The prizes were awarded for design and innovation in the use of ESRI GIS technology.

In the category “Central Administration” was awarded the Ministry of Environment and Waters for “Outstanding Achievement in GIS implementation for water management.” The award was presented to Mr. Vladimir Stratiev Head office and adviser to the Minister of Environment and Water, by Tove Skarsteyn Her Excellency, Ambassador of Norway to Bulgaria.

In the same category the Executive Environment Agency was awarded too for “Excellence in GIS implementation for the conservation of biodiversity in Bulgaria.” The award was presented to the Secretary General of the Agency, Mr. Philip Penchev by Mr. Vladimir Stratiev head office in MEW.

In the category “Transportation” has been awarded the prize of the National Company “Railway Infrastructure” for “Outstanding Achievement in GIS implementation of effective modern management of the railway infrastructure.” The award was presented to Mr. Milcho Lambrev, Director General of the National Company “Railway Infrastructure”, by Mrs. Evgeniya Karadjova Director of ESRI Bulgaria.

In the category “Engineering Infrastructure” was awarded Sofia Water Corp. for “Innovative corporate GIS for integrated management of water infrastructure.” Award was received by the procurator of Sofia Water Mr. Jean Salles by Mr. Angel Semerdziev, chairman of SEWRC.
